Beatrice Alice Louisa Davis was born in 1892 in Oldham, Lancashire, England, the child of Francis James Davis And Elizabeth Fox. In 1901, Beatrice Alice Louisa Davis was recorded in the census in 90, Napier Street, Oldham, Lancashire, England. In 1911, Beatrice Alice Louisa Davis was recorded in the census in 44 Peter Street, Oldham, Lancashire, England. Beatrice Alice Louisa Davis married Edgar George Rogers, and had children including Elsie Maud Rogers, Francis S Rogers. Beatrice Alice Louisa Davis passed away in 1969 in St George's Church, Modbury, Devon, England.
